Davido questions his choice of music career, says footballers enjoy better fame

Nigerian music sensation David Adeleke, popularly known as Davido, has recently raised eyebrows by openly questioning his career path, expressing a hint of regret over choosing music over football.

The acclaimed artist, renowned for his chart-topping hits and flamboyant lifestyle, admitted to moments of contemplation when observing the lavish lifestyles enjoyed by professional footballers.

Davido confessed that witnessing the extravagant lives of footballers often triggers reflections on his own career decisions.

He lamented the allure of the luxury and fame associated with the football world, contrasting it with the path he has chosen in the music industry.

While he has occasionally showcased his football skills, it remains unclear how much of a role the sport could have played in his life had he pursued it professionally.

Despite his reservations, Davido’s undeniable talent and impact on the music scene continue to captivate audiences worldwide, solidifying his status as a cultural icon.
